This is a nightly build of the CKSource Rich Text Editor. It is fully aria-enabled and IBM worked with Mozilla to get MSAA and IAccessible2 right to support for rich text editing on the level of an office application - to the extend that this editor acts like a word processor. The editor supports contenteditable. This a nice ARIA test and a great test for browsers needing to support accessibility API for contenteditable sections - a standard HTML 5 feature.
